4:00 pm
Tri-Dimensional
This eclectic group of young Jazz musicians will delight
audiences with their contemporary sound. The band includes Hermon
Mehari who has been playing trumpet for seven years. He was in the
All-State Jazz Band and went to Jefferson City High School. Hermon
attends UMKC as a jazz studies major. Brian Steever handles the drummer
and is a graduate of Helias High School. He was in the All-State Jazz
Band plays a lot around the mid Missouri area.
Zach Beeson plays the bass. He just graduated from Rock Bridge High
School in Columbia and studies music at the University of Missouri-St.
Louis. |

8:00 pm
Q106.1 Street dance
featuring Bobby Showers and the Beatbox
Bobby Showers
and the Beatbox is a native Jefferson City band combining acoustic and
electric guitars, beat box, live drum beats, turntables and harmonicas
to create a sound that represents the best of today’s current music
scene. The Beatbox staring Bobby on lead vocals, acoustic guitar,
harmonica and beatbox, Jon Hagood on lead and acoustic guitars, Justin
Steele on drums and Sam Walker on turntables plays original and cover
songs ranging from Americana, pop, folk rock, blues, folk hop and R&B.

5:30 pm
Cold Blue
Tim Taylor and Lonnie Simmons of Jefferson City together have been
serving up the blues since 1994. Explosive and searing electric guitar,
electric slide guitar and blues harmonica backed by long time session
bass guitarist Tony Perkins and percussionist drummer Mark Ludwig both
of Jefferson City. Cold Blue cooks up some of the best nonstop jam
sessions with injections of their own original music as well as music
from Jimi Hendrix, John Lee Hooker, SRV, Freddie King and many other
great blues legends.

7:30 pm
Megan Boyer Band
The Megan
Boyer Band is an acoustic Blues and Roots band hailing from Central
Missouri. MBB plays everything from traditional blues and bluegrass to
unplugged classic rock. The big-smiling, big-voiced, big-hearted,
fearless front-woman of the band, Ms. Megan Boyer, is a natural born
blues ‘n roots singer/guitarist guaranteed to rock the house and delight
audiences. Throw into the mix the sixty-odd years of solid musicianship
and dedication to the craft represented by Tim Shields and Jimmy Steffan,
and the megan Boyer Band might just be one heck of a train ride from
Bluestown to Rootsville. “It’s Like Dat!”
